Jonas Soldini kommer från Corpataux i den fransktalande delen av Schweiz. Han är född år 2000 och har därmed valt att inleda sin karriär i seniorklassen i SNO. Under åren som junior har har han redan visat framfötterna, bland annat genom en 8:e plats på JVM-långdistansen 2019! Kort intervju:
Where do you live and what do you do for a living at the moment?
I live with my family in Corpataux, it’s a small village located in the French speaking part of Switzerland. I am currently in the gymnasium as an elite sportsman until July 2022.
Why did you choose SNO and what are you looking forward to the most in the club?
I chose SNO according to various established criteria. Firstly, I wanted a club located in Sweden to learn about Swedish culture and accessible fairly easily by transport (flight/train) so that I could come and do training courses in the area. In addition, I was looking for a club with good elite runners so that I could progress on the Nordic terrain. Finally, I would like to be able to join the SNO team to take part in the big relays 😊
What are your goals for 2021?
My goals for 2021 as a young elite runner would be to qualify for a world cup stage (Switzerland, Sweden or Italy). In addition, I would like to be able to participate in the Tiomila and Jukola with SNO!
